NRS 293B.122 Purchase of systems or devices by Secretary of State for lease to counties; sources of money to pay for such purchases.
1. The Secretary of State may purchase mechanical voting systems and mechanical recording devices and lease them to:
(a)A county whose population is 100,000 or more pursuant to the provisions of NRS 293B.124 .
(b)A county whose population is less than 100,000 pursuant to the provisions of NRS 293B.124 or 293B.1245 .
2. The Secretary of State may pay for such systems and devices purchased pursuant to subsection 1 out of any money:
(a)Specifically appropriated for that purpose by the Legislature; or
(b)In an account established pursuant to NRS 293B.124 or 293B.1245 .
